What does "pull up to my bumper" means? thanks

It can have different meanings depending on the situation, but the usual meaning of "Pull up to my bumper" means to drive up your car close enough to my car so that it almost touches the bumper (rubber or metal bar that absorbs a car impact) or the back of my car. You might use this expression when you are trying to make sure there is enough space for everyone to park.
As for the meaning of the expression in song lyrics, it is a little more suggestive... Ha, ha.
